The france energy saving & fluorescent market was estimated at USD 238 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 264 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 1.1% from 2026 to 2032.
The France Energy Saving & Fluorescent market underwent a significant rebound after the -4.0% contraction in 2021, fueled by heightened consumer awareness and policy initiatives promoting energy efficiency. In 2022, growth surged to 6.8%, driven by investments in advanced lighting technologies and a robust shift towards sustainable energy solutions. Although the growth rate moderated to 3.2% in 2023 and is projected to average around 1.8% to 2.3% through 2032, the upward trend reflects ongoing digitalization in energy management and increasing infrastructural commitments to green technologies. Additionally, consumer demand for eco-friendly products continues to bolster investments, crucial for the sector's long-term sustainability in the evolving energy landscape.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
